Sunset
Magnar Børnes  Norway
A blue anemone with the sunset behind it. A flash was used to enhance the blue colour of the flower while the sun was partially hidden behind some trees, in order to soften the light a little.

Pentax K10D with Pentax FA 200mm macro; ISO 100; pattern metering; 1/45 sec at f/5.6


Judges' Comments

“This isn’t a finely detailed study of what a Hepatica looks like, it’s all about the surge of hope we all feel with the return of spring. It doesn’t even matter that the flower isn’t in focus as the strong, complementary colours are much more valuable to the shot. Everything signals excitement.”

Autumn Leaf
Annette Blattman  Australia
Sublime lighting on a single leaf just evokes the whole feeling of autumn in this shot. The colours are rich and the lighting is warm and inviting. Excellent use of colour and control of the overall lighting.

Canon EOS 300D with Tamron 90mm macro lens; ISO 200; evaluative metering; 1/200 sec at f/2.8.


Judges' Comments

“Perfect autumnal colours and a splendid example of how carefully controlled light can really saturate the richness of the yellows and reds in a leaf. Very evocative.”
